Celtic Quest – An Interactive Storytelling App

Celtic Quest is an interactive storytelling app specifically designed for primary school children aged 5-8 in Ireland, with a core mission of promoting literacy through a gamified reading experience. This engaging app brings the enchanting world of Irish mythology to life, using the captivating tale of the Giant’s Causeway as its central narrative.

Celtic Quest combines voice-over narration with animated text to support young readers, particularly those who struggle with reading. The voice-over includes a variety of Irish, Scottish and English accents, ensuring that children not only learn accurate pronunciation but also experience a sense of cultural immersion. This unique feature distinguishes Celtic Quest from other reading apps, making it a powerful tool for enhancing language skills. There is background music, sound effects of waves, and an angry Giant who likes to roar!

The app’s gamified elements, such as interactive storytelling choices and achievement rewards, make reading an enjoyable adventure rather than a chore. By making reading fun and accessible, Celtic Quest aims to foster a love for literacy among young users, ultimately helping reduce Ireland’s high rates of adult illiteracy in the long term. Experience Depop - Pop Up Shop incentive for community engagement

Experience Depop is a dynamic, community-first campaign designed to make Depop the talk of the town by blending online and off-line engagement. This innovative word-of-mouth initiative aims to spotlight Depop as the go-to destination for buying and selling fashion through a series of engaging experiences.

At the heart of the campaign is a traveling marquee pop-up shop (for smaller towns), a physical shop (for bigger cities) complete with a photo-booth and the Trend Roulette Challenge (#ExperienceDepop). Shoppers can participate in the Trend Roulette Challenge by engaging with fun styling prompts, sharing their looks on social media, and competing for rewards. Real-time challenges and prizes, including influencer meet-and-greets and early access to exclusive drops, further amplify excitement.

The campaign’s success is driven by four key factors:

  • Hyper-Engagement: Community-driven activities put buyers and sellers at the forefront.
  • Reward & Gamification: Incentives encourage repeat participation.
  • Social Virality: Trend Roulette, photobooth moments, and social teasers generate organic buzz.
  • Low Budget, High Impact: A strategic mix of digital, physical pop-ups, and word-of-mouth tactics deliver significant exposure without a massive budget.
